Wonk 03-23-2005, 08:45 PM My girlfriend has had HSV2 for several years and I have had HSV1 for a short time. Is she protected from getting HSV1 from casual kissing even if I am having an outbreak? hsvmom 03-23-2005, 11:15 PM No. one type of virus doesn't protect anyone from the other type. But...there is discussion out there as to whether or not having one type can make the infection of a second type less severe. You still need to be careful not to spread HSV-1 to her. Several people here have both 1 & 2. Interestingly enough, in ongoing trials, HSV-2 vaccines are proving to be most effective in women who test negative to BOTH HSV-1 and HSV-2. If having one form lent any sort of protection against the other, then you might expect the opposite to be true. |
